Recovery Timeline: What to Really Expect

The question: how long is recovery after hip replacement? The following is the separate realistic timeline:


Early recovery (Days 1–7):

 

  • Start walking with the aid immediately after surgery.

  • Average hospital length of stay 2–4 days.

  • Sufferings treated by drugs.


Progressive recovery (Weeks 2–6):

 

  • Progressively extend walking distance.

  • Minimise the reliance on aids in walking.

  • Train muscle wellness via training.


Full recovery (Months 3–6):

 

  • The vast majority of the patients are able to walk comfortably.

  • Go back to moderated exercises and jobs.

  • Approximately normal operation attained.


Issues that influence your healing:

 

  • Age and overall health

  • Complaints with rehabilitation plans

  • Pre-surgery fitness level

Understanding the Risks

Patients usually enquire on the risks of the hip replacement surgery prior to their decision.


Potential risks:

 

  • Infection 1–2 %of cases.

  • Dislocation- may be prevented with good care.


How risks are reduced:

 

  • Advanced surgical practise.

  • Experienced surgical teams

  • Preventive medicine and processes
